Subject outline

Design Studies 3 extends the exploration into a variety of design industry practices in advertising, publishing, editorial and information design on a range of platforms. Projects support a growing understanding of design industry sectors and project outcomes are developed to an industry presentation visual standard. Attention is paid to typographic design, copy and text, creation and application of visual imagery, photographic, illustrative and contemporary marketing concepts. Subject matter is explored through formal briefings and theoretical discussions, and further developed by critique of project outcomes with industry, client, peer/ colleague, and lecturer focus.
